Software to be completed by December 31, 2009
34
• Implementation of rotation attribute in the presence of structural deformation (sensitive to wrench faults)
• Implementation of angular unconformity attribute in the presence of structural deformation
• Incorporation of phase residues into spec_cmp
• Euler curvature and apparent dip utilities (multiple output volumes) with GUIs
• Rose diagrams at user-defined output locations (x,y well coordinates)
• Principal component analysis of multiattributes with GUI
• Simple Petrel display and attribute manipulation plug-ins
